Key technologies behind color temperature adjustment

The key technologies behind color temperature adjustment in smart lights primarily involve advanced LED configurations and driver circuitry. These components enable precise control over the light’s warm-to-cool spectrum, creating customizable lighting environments.

One fundamental technology is the use of tunable white LEDs, which combine multiple LED chips emitting different color temperatures. These can be mixed seamlessly to produce a wide range of lighting options.

Control systems incorporate digital signal processors (DSPs) and microcontrollers that adjust the intensity of individual LEDs based on user input or predefined settings. This allows smart lights with color temperature control to respond accurately to changing preferences.

Additionally, some systems utilize phosphor layering or quantum dot technology to fine-tune the light spectrum further, enhancing color rendering and consistency. These technological advancements work together to provide smooth, reliable adjustment of color temperature in smart lighting solutions.

Enhancing productivity and relaxation

Smart lights with color temperature control significantly contribute to enhancing productivity and relaxation by optimizing lighting conditions to match the desired environment and activity. Adjusting color temperature allows users to create lighting settings that foster focus or calmness, depending on their needs.

During work or study sessions, cooler white light (around 5000-6500K) can invigorate and improve concentration, making tasks easier to accomplish. Conversely, warmer tones (around 2700-3500K) promote relaxation and reduce stress during leisure or winding-down periods. This flexibility supports a balanced daily routine.

Moreover, the ability to fine-tune lighting helps improve sleep quality by transitioning to warmer hues in the evening, encouraging natural melatonin production. Smart lights with color temperature control thus enable users to cultivate an environment conducive to mental clarity or relaxation, depending on the time of day or activity at hand.

Limitations and challenges of smart lights with color temperature control

Despite their advantages, smart lights with color temperature control face notable limitations. Compatibility issues can arise, as not all fixtures or home systems support advanced features, potentially restricting their functionality or requiring additional setup.

Another challenge involves user complexity; adjusting color temperature precisely may demand familiarity with app interfaces or voice commands, which can be confusing for some users. This complexity may hinder widespread adoption or consistent use.

Furthermore, cost can be a barrier since smart lights with adjustable color temperature often have higher initial prices compared to standard lighting options. Additional expenses may include upgrades for existing wiring or hubs, impacting overall affordability.

Lastly, technological reliability remains a concern. Connectivity disruptions, software glitches, or firmware updates can intermittently affect the performance of smart lights with color temperature control, thereby reducing their dependability in everyday use.
